Title :
Memory copies in multi-level memory systems
Author :
De Langen, Pepijn ; Juurlink, Ben
Author_Institution :
Comput. Eng. Lab., Delft Univ. of Technol., Delft
Abstract :
Data movement operations, such as the C-style memcpy function, are often used to duplicate or communicate data. This type of function typically produces a significant amount of off-chip traffic. For current microprocessors, communication with off-chip memory is an increasing limitation to attain higher performance as well as a significant source of energy consumption. To decrease the amount of communication between a CPU and the off-chip memory system, we propose a system that implements a hardware memcpy in the memory level where the source data is located.
Keywords :
energy consumption; microprocessor chips; storage management; C-style memcpy function; data duplication; data movement operation; energy consumption; microprocessor off chip traffic; multilevel memory system; Buffer storage; Computer science; Data engineering; Energy consumption; Hardware; Laboratories; Mathematics; Microprocessors; Operating systems; Pollution;
Conference_Titel :
Application-Specific Systems, Architectures and Processors, 2008. ASAP 2008. International Conference on
Conference_Location :
Leuven
Print_ISBN :
978-1-4244-1897-8
Electronic_ISBN :
2160-0511
DOI :
10.1109/ASAP.2008.4580192